Correct option is B
Given: 100 : 45 :: 200 : 70 : 300 : ?
Logic: 2nd 4 – 80 = 1st number
100 : 45 → 45 4 – 80 = 180 – 80 = 100
and
200 : 70 → 70 4 – 80 = 280 – 80 = 200
Similarly,
300 : ? → ? 4 – 80 = 300
? 4 = 300 + 80
? 4 = 380
? = 95
Correct answer is (b) 95.